Which plant has a flower?

Which plant has a flower? Angiosperms are distinguished from the other major seed plant clade, the gymnosperms, by having flowers, xylem consisting of vessel elements instead of tracheids, endosperm within their seeds, and fruits that completely envelop the seeds. What flower is used for insect repellent?

What flower is used for insect repellent? Marigold marigolds, an easy-to-grow annual flower, emit a smell that deters mosquitoes. Grow them in pots and place them near your patio or entrance to your home to keep bugs out. Marigolds are also a popular addition to borders and vegetable gardens. Which plant has always flowers?

Which plant has always flowers? Often kept as a flowering houseplant, the african violet displays purple, pink, or white blooms throughout the entire year. Yes, they even flower in winter! If your plants aren’t flowering, make sure they’re receiving lots of light (a sunny kitchen windowsill is a great home) and their soil remains moist.

What helps flowers grow the best?

What helps flowers grow the best? Fertilising your plants regularly in spring and summer is a great way to keep them healthy. Look for a good quality fertiliser that has the “big three” nutrients you need for flowers – nitrogen, phosphorous/phosphate and potassium/potash.
